When work is needed at the crucial point of connection in between a private property and the public electrical energy network, homeowner and companies should engage the highly skilled services of a certified Northern Beaches Level 2 Electrician. This expert is most importantly various from a basic certified tradesperson; they possess a necessary, particular certification called Accredited Service Provider (ASP) Level 2, provided by the state's energy distributors. This accreditation grants them the distinct legal authority to perform complex, high-risk tasks directly on the supply side of the electrical power meter, which is crucial for the safety and dependability of power across this comprehensive coastal strip.

As a Level 2 Electrician, this professional has the authority to work on the electrical facilities directly linked to a residential or commercial property, consisting of mains, service lines, and metering equipment. This capability is essential when homeowner need increased power capability, such as updating from a single-phase to a three-phase supply for installations like lifts, photovoltaic panels, or large air conditioning systems. Unlike basic electricians, a Northern Beaches Level 2 Electrician is certified to safely disconnect power from the grid, carry out network upgrades, and reconnect the home in compliance with existing regulative requirements.

A major and typically ignored duty of a Northern Beaches Level 2 Electrician is the thorough management of personal power poles-- a common function on properties with long driveways, challenging surface, or challenging block configurations common of the peninsula. These poles need regular assessment, repair, and often replacement due to age or inescapable storm damage. The Level 2 accreditation is the only thing that allows an electrician to safely climb these structures, perform essential live work, and ensure the point of accessory fulfills all height and structural standards set by the electrical energy supplier, thus keeping a safe and secure and trustworthy connection.

Dealing with electrical flaw notifications is a crucial service that highlights the value of having a Northern Beaches Level 2 Electrician supervise local security standards. Network operators consistently check properties and issue problem notices for various issues like inadequate earthing systems, broken customer mains, or faulty primary switches. Failure to deal with these notifications within the offered deadline can lead to the property's power supply being lawfully detached by the distributor. Given that most of these crucial defects involve high-voltage systems, just a Northern Beaches Level 2 Electrician is certified to perform the essential repair work, ensure compliance, and submit the required paperwork to the supplier quickly. This process ensures that the home stays powered and certified with security policies without unnecessary hold-ups.
